Jake Bauers’ game-ending single lifts NL Central-clinching Brewers to 2-1 win over the Phillies

https://img.particlenews.com/image.php?url=3pMH97_0vbbeM0i00

MILWAUKEE (AP) — Jake Bauers hit an RBI single in the ninth inning and the Milwaukee Brewers, who had clinched the NL Central earlier when the Cubs lost, beat Philadelphia 2-1 on Wednesday night to prevent the Phillies from securing a playoff berth.

Bauers’ hit off Phillies closer Carlos Estévez (4-5) scored Jackson Chourio, who had tripled.

“I think the vibe in the clubhouse all day was, that’s great that we (clinched), but we need to win this game,” Bauers said. “It was intense, man, it was intense. You could feel the pressure.”…
